Boutique Hotel Le Penfield
Boutique Hotel Le Penfield is a 19-room property occupying a historic building in Montreal's Latin Quarter. The interior blends old character with contemporary decoration, and the adjoining café/bistro/patisserie, owned by the same family, serves breakfast included in the stay.
Guests consistently call the service exceptional, often singling out Albert, and the location puts you close to Berri-UQAM metro, St. Denis Street's dining and nightlife, and the Old Town's sights.

Worth weighing
3 to weigh- No elevator — The historic building lacks an elevator, which can be a consideration for those with mobility concerns or heavy luggage, though staff have been known to help with bags.
- Parking costs extra — On-site parking isn't listed; a guest mentions underground parking across the street costing $15. Budget for this separately.
- A small, intimate scale — With only 19 rooms, the hotel can book out quickly and may lack the facilities of larger properties.

Getting around Montreal
The property sits in Montreal.
Latin Quarter: Stay on St. Denis Street, surrounded by restaurants, cafés, and clubs. The nearby Berri-UQAM metro station connects to three lines.
Old Town: A moderate stroll from the hotel, Old Montreal's historic streets and harbour are walkable.
